Scope and Contents

Contents

Endolichenic fungi within 17 lichen species in the area near Ny-Aalesund (Svalbard, High Arctic) were studied by a culture-based method. The 247 fungal isolates were obtained from 2712 lichen thallus segments. The colonization rate of endolichenic fungi ranged from 1.6 to 26.5 %, respectively.
